The Bend News
Thursday, November 29, 2007 • Posted November 29, 2007

The long awaited rain did come at last. Over an inch was received at and around the Bend. There was no snow but a little bit of sleet Friday night, not enough to hardly notice. The moisture is certainly welcome.

The Price family had the family of Jim, Patty and Thomas Caughman from Houston over the Thanksgiving holidays. They, along with Robert, Spring and Haley Price, enjoyed all the turkey and trimmings that go along with Thanksgiving. Friday afternoon, the Caughman family and the Price family did some Christmas shopping in Killeen and afterward stopped by the Red Lobster for a bite to eat.

Lola Morris reported that she enjoyed Thanksgiving in the home of her son, along with other relatives. She enjoyed seeing her great grandson, Sean Nixon, and granddaughter, Dedrie Nixon, of Woodlands; and Dennis and Dora Ann Hayter of Pasadena, who also visited the family.

William and Jane Clark held the family reunion of the late Edmond and Elsia Henniger over the Thanksgiving holidays with many family members attending.

The home of Tommie and Jane Tinney was bursting at the seams with relatives over the Thanksgiving holidays.

The home of Leon and Mebbie Eckhoff was a very busy place over the long weekend. They enjoyed a Thanksgiving meal in Killeen with some members of the family. On Friday, Robbie, Amy, Ethan and Ory Eckhoff came in sick with some sort of virus. Friday night, Leon took Robbie and Ethan to the emergency room in Lampasas. Leon also came down with whatever it was and Mebbie seemed to be the only one not that did not have it. Robbie and his family felt well enough Monday to go home. Robbie and his family were visiting Amy’s parents in Hawley and had left to come to Bend but got caught in the snow storm in Abilene where they spent the night. They got to Bend Friday bringing the little bug with them. This will be one Thanksgiving that the Eckhoff family will remember for some time to come.

Football continues for Jerome and Shirley Meischen as the Leander team won a close game Friday in Huntsville against Houston Klein Oaks with a score of 27-24. The weather was very cold but everyone wrapped up in a lot of clothing. There were eighteen people in the cheering squad for Blake Gideon and his team-mates. Both Blake and David McBride played a very good game on offense and defense, as did the other team members. Blake and David have roots in San Saba and Bend, and their grandparents are very proud of them.

This Saturday, Leander will play against Longview in Corsicana at 2 PM. So once again, there will be eighteen to twenty-five people on the road again to cheer the team on.

Happy Birthday wishes go out to Nathan Poor whose birthday is November 29 and to Lewvon Hicks who will celebrate a birthday December 5.

Congratulations go out to Tim and CheeChee Brockman who will be celebrating their anniversary November 30.
